2005 Jeep Wrangler vs. 1969 Skoda 1202

To start off, 2005 Jeep Wrangler is newer by 36 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1969 Skoda 1202.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1969 Skoda 1202 would be higher. At 3,966 cc (6 cylinders), 2005 Jeep Wrangler is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2005 Jeep Wrangler (191 HP @ 3800 RPM) has 147 more horse power than 1969 Skoda 1202. (44 HP @ 4200 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2005 Jeep Wrangler should accelerate faster than 1969 Skoda 1202.

Because 2005 Jeep Wrangler is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 1969 Skoda 1202.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2005 Jeep Wrangler will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2005 Jeep Wrangler (319 Nm) has 234 more torque (in Nm) than 1969 Skoda 1202. (85 Nm). This means 2005 Jeep Wrangler will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1969 Skoda 1202.
